Interactive virtual lab simulations are digital platforms that allow students and learners to perform scientific experiments, engineering tasks, or biological procedures in a simulated environment. These tools provide an immersive, interactive experience that replicates the hands-on aspects of real-world labs, enabling users to practice concepts safely and cost-effectively from anywhere with internet access.

Pros
- Enhances understanding through visual and hands-on interaction
- Accessible anytime and anywhere, promoting flexible learning
- Reduces safety risks associated with physical experiments
- Cost-effective alternative to traditional labs
- Allows repeated practice for mastery of concepts
Cons
- Can lack the tactile feedback of real instruments
- May not fully replicate complex physical phenomena accurately
- Dependent on good internet connectivity and device compatibility
- Potentially limited in scope compared to real-world experimentation
- Requires investment in quality simulation software
